Today, we join the global community in raising awareness about stroke prevention and recognition. Every second counts when it comes to stroke!

โšก Remember F.A.S.T.:
Face drooping
Arm weakness
Speech difficulty
Time to call 112

Stroke strikes in an instant, but quick action can change everything. Recognizing these signs and acting immediately can save lives and prevent long-term disability.

Thyroid cancer often develops without obvious symptoms, making regular screening and self-awareness essential for early intervention and improved outcomes.

Recognize the Warning Signs:
* Persistent neck discomfort or pain
* Swelling or palpable lumps in the throat area
* Voice changes or difficulty swallowing

Take Action:
* Schedule regular check-ups with your healthcare provider
* Perform monthly neck self-examinations

Today, on World Mosquito Day, we at the University of Banja Luka Faculty of Medicine pause to reflect on one of humanity's greatest health challenges. Despite their tiny size, mosquitoes remain the world's deadliest creatures, responsible for over 1 million deaths annually through diseases like malaria, dengue fever, chikungunya, and Zika virus.

The statistics are sobering - every 30 seconds, a child dies from malaria. Dengue fever affects millions globally each year. Yet these tragedies are largely preventable with proper education, resources, and preventive measures. Simple actions like using mosquito nets, applying repellent, eliminating standing water, and using mosquito coils can save countless lives.
